Why Thrust Needle Roller Bearings Matter

Thrust needle roller bearings excel in applications where axial loads are prevalent. Their compact design, combined with high load-carrying capacity, makes them ideal for space-constrained environments. According to the American Bearing Manufacturers Association (ABMA), thrust needle roller bearings can withstand axial loads up to 90% of their radial load capacity. This exceptional strength ensures reliable performance even under demanding loads.

Effective Strategies, Tips, and Tricks

To maximize the performance and lifespan of thrust needle roller bearings, consider the following best practices:

  • Proper lubrication: Use recommended lubricants to minimize wear and extend bearing life.
  • Adequate cooling: Ensure proper heat dissipation to prevent overheating and premature failure.
  • Proper mounting: Follow manufacturer guidelines for accurate bearing installation and alignment.

Common Mistakes to Avoid

  • Using bearings with insufficient load capacity.
  • Incorrect lubrication or overheating.
  • Inadequate sealing, leading to contamination.

FAQs About Thrust Needle Roller Bearings

Q: What is the difference between thrust needle roller bearings and radial needle roller bearings?
A: Thrust needle roller bearings are designed to handle axial loads, while radial needle roller bearings accommodate radial loads.

Q: Can thrust needle roller bearings be used in high-speed applications?
A: Yes, certain types of thrust needle roller bearings are suitable for high-speed operation. Consult with bearing manufacturers for specific speed ratings.

Q: How can I extend the lifespan of thrust needle roller bearings?
A: Implement proper lubrication, cooling, and mounting practices. Regularly inspect and maintain bearings to identify potential issues early on.
